[Remote] Enterprise Account Executive (Mid-Atlantic)
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. Knit is an AI-native consumer research platform focused on automating and accelerating primary research for enterprise brands. The Account Executive will drive growth by securing new enterprise partnerships and expanding existing client relationships through strategic cross-selling while collaborating with internal teams to align products with client needs.
Responsibilities
- Drive net-new revenue by identifying, engaging, and closing partnerships with enterprise organizations
- Collaborate deeply with Research and Customer Success teams throughout the sales process to ensure Knit's products align perfectly with client needs
- Lead a consultative, insight-driven sales process from discovery through close, positioning Knit as a trusted partner—not just a vendor
- Develop tailored outreach strategies to generate new introductions while partnering with Marketing on inbound interest
- Ensure seamless handoffs post-sale, clearly articulating client goals, key stakeholders, and success criteria
- Identify cross-sell opportunities within existing clients, expanding Knit’s footprint across business units and functions
- Maintain high standards for pipeline integrity, forecasting accuracy, and documentation across every stage of the deal cycle
- Represent Knit at conferences, trade shows, and industry events, showcasing our AI-native insights capabilities and building relationships with prospective clients
- Continuously experiment and improve, bringing creativity, curiosity, and proactive thinking to how we sell and engage
Skills
- 5+ years of experience leading a consultative, full-cycle enterprise sales process
- Consistent track record of hitting or exceeding $1M+ annual sales quotas
- Experience selling $100K+ annual contracts to Fortune 1000 companies
- Sales approach with a strong emphasis on discovery - running a process that is extremely thoughtful, intentional, curious and consultative
- Exceptionally organized with disciplined pipeline management and attention to detail
- Deep curiosity and the ability to translate complex ideas into clear, compelling value
- Experience working in a collaborative, fast-scaling environment, alongside customer success, marketing, and product teams
- A builder's mindset - comfortable navigating ambiguity and energized by shaping the sales playbook as we grow
- Direct experience selling into Insights, Analytics, or Marketing teams at enterprise organizations
- Familiarity with market research tools, methodologies, or data platforms
- Background in SaaS, AI, or technology-enabled services that drive strategic decision-making
- Experience working in high-growth or startup environments where processes and playbooks are still being built
